发明名称 基于粒子群算法的鲁棒控制优化方法
摘要 本发明提出一种基于粒子群算法的鲁棒控制优化方法,包括:步骤1、确定被控对象的加权函数W<sub>1</sub>、W<sub>2</sub>、W<sub>3</sub>;步骤2、将加权函数中K<sub>1</sub>和ω<sub>c</sub>作为粒子群中各粒子的参数,通过粒子群算法优化K<sub>1</sub>和ω<sub>c</sub>,并输出H<sub>∞</sub>控制器。本发明通过在鲁棒控制方法中引入粒子群算法,优化被控对象加权函数的参数,不仅提高了加权函数的参数优化精确度,得出的鲁棒H<sub>∞</sub>控制器可使被控对象的性能在约束范围内达到最优,应用范围更广泛,设计简单、使用更灵活;本发明在鲁棒控制方法中引入粒子群算法,还解决了现有技术鲁棒H<sub>∞</sub>控制器中加权函数的选择凭借专家经验的劣势,使得无经验的学者亦能轻松合理地构造出加权函数,并得出最优鲁棒H<sub>∞</sub>控制器。
申请公布号 CN105892292A 申请公布日期 2016.08.24
申请号 CN201410858303.7 申请日期 2014.12.31
申请人 国家电网公司;中国电力科学研究院 发明人 李相俊;陈金元;谢巍;惠东;胡娟
分类号 G05B13/04(2006.01)I 主分类号 G05B13/04(2006.01)I
代理机构 北京安博达知识产权代理有限公司 11271 代理人 徐国文
主权项 一种基于粒子群算法的鲁棒控制优化方法,其特征在于:该方法包括:步骤1、确定被控对象的加权函数W<sub>1</sub>、W<sub>2</sub>、W<sub>3</sub>,其传递函数表达式如下:<maths num="0001" id="cmaths0001"><math><![CDATA[<mrow><msub><mi>W</mi><mn>1</mn></msub><mo>=</mo><mfrac><msub><mi>K</mi><mn>1</mn></msub><mrow><mfrac><msub><mi>K</mi><mn>1</mn></msub><msub><mi>&omega;</mi><mi>c</mi></msub></mfrac><mi>s</mi><mo>+</mo><mn>1</mn></mrow></mfrac></mrow>]]></math><img file="FSA0000113671240000011.GIF" wi="227" he="159" /></maths><maths num="0002" id="cmaths0002"><math><![CDATA[<mrow><msub><mi>W</mi><mn>2</mn></msub><mo>=</mo><mfrac><msqrt><mn>2</mn></msqrt><msub><mi>u</mi><mi>max</mi></msub></mfrac></mrow>]]></math><img file="FSA0000113671240000012.GIF" wi="173" he="122" /></maths><maths num="0003" id="cmaths0003"><math><![CDATA[<mrow><msub><mi>W</mi><mn>3</mn></msub><mo>=</mo><mfrac><mn>1</mn><msub><mrow><mn>5</mn><mi>&omega;</mi></mrow><mi>C</mi></msub></mfrac><mi>s</mi><mo>+</mo><mfrac><mn>1</mn><mn>10</mn></mfrac></mrow>]]></math><img file="FSA0000113671240000013.GIF" wi="281" he="107" /></maths>式中,W<sub>1</sub>为对灵敏度函数S的加权函数,W<sub>2</sub>为对控制量u的加权函数,W<sub>3</sub>为对补灵敏度函数T的加权函数,K<sub>1</sub>为被控对象期望的低频增益,ω<sub>c</sub>为被控对象期望的剪切频率,s为拉普拉斯算子,u<sub>max</sub>为控制量u的上限值;步骤2、将加权函数中K<sub>1</sub>和ω<sub>c</sub>作为粒子群中各粒子的参数,通过粒子群算法优化K<sub>1</sub>和ω<sub>c</sub>,并输出H<sub>∞</sub>控制器。
地址 100031 北京市西城区西长安街86号